People Score in 47175, Taswell, Indiana

The People Score for the Alzheimers Score in 47175, Taswell, Indiana is 43 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 97.30 percent of the residents in 47175 has some form of health insurance. 36.04 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 80.18 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 47175 would have to travel an average of 15.81 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Indiana University Health Paoli Hospital. In a 20-mile radius, there are 16 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 47175, Taswell, Indiana.
